Ford Mustang Mach-E Offers High Voltage Excitement

If Elon can learn anything from Elvis, perhaps it is lonely at the top. Ford has recently committed to a partnership with old friends at Volkswagen to share EV development. Not only will they share ideas and strategies, but production costs will be amortized by a renewing of ties between Dearborn and Deutschland. Ford will reconnect with American workers at VW’s Chattanooga plant, and buyers of the Ford Mustang Mach-E will receive high voltage excitement.

In a press release earlier today, we learned that new Mach-E owners will receive 250 kilowatt-hours of complimentary charging at Electrify America locations. Roughly the equivalent of five full charges, using this credit to top off your Mach-E could last a few months at least. Another first is Ford’s charging box. The 240-volt home charger will be offered ahead of debut. This will allow owners to have their garages ready for the new Mustang. Only $799, it is available from any dealer and easy to install.
